IVF with PCOS: what to expect and how to prepare

Image
Understanding PCOS and its impact on fertility Polycystic ovary syndrome (PCOS) is one of the most common hormonal disorders affecting women of reproductive age, with estimates suggesting it impacts 1 in 5 women in India. Characterised by irregular ovulation, elevated androgen levels, and the presence of multiple small follicles in the ovaries, PCOS can make natural conception more challenging — but it does not make it impossible. For women who have not achieved pregnancy through ovulation induction or intrauterine insemination (IUI), in vitro fertilisation (IVF) is often the next recommended step. Understanding what the IVF process looks like specifically for PCOS patients — and how to prepare your body for it — can make a significant difference in your experience and outcomes.
